My opinion about "Should We Be Able To Resell Our Ebooks? (First Sale Rights)"
is YES because of the word "able". We should have that right, because it doesn't prevent any other rights or duties. However, it shouldn't imply a worse DRM v.2 or any other restrictions that are greater than the benefit. And this is the big problem, because the benefit of that capability (right) is really low to my opinion (except as to maintain a right, as a principle). I can see only two other reasons that can be beneficial: 1) be able to offer it; 2) be able to get some money back for expensive books. Personally, I like my (physical) books and never sold one. Maybe it will be different with e-books, don't know yet. One fundamental right that is far more important and beneficial to my opinion is: the right to share it and then get it back (temporary exchange of properties) Finally, as someone said, uniquely identifiable or single copy seem in contradiction with the essence of digital data. We must have the right to make or get exact copies for back-up purpose, as we should have to pay for the "created value" and for the "effective cost to transmit it to the customer". At the moment, it seems that we sometimes pay the price for the "corresponding product of another technology"... My 2 cents. Last edited by Thierry.C; 03-23-2011 at 07:24 PM. |
